c#位运算

1、位运算符

~运算符(取反)

11001100(204)----00110011(51)

<<运算符(移位)

204<<2 (11001100---00110000)

&运算符(或)

204&20(11001100&0001000) ---------8(00001000)

^运算符(异或)两个操作数相反是为1

204^24(11001100&00011000)-----212(11010100)

posted @ 2012-06-23 19:38  真诚待  阅读(123)  评论(0编辑  收藏  举报